# Session Handling — Build Agent Clock Skew

Build agents in the Copperwheel fleet sign session tickets with a five-minute validity window. If an agent's clock drifts more than 90 seconds from the Tidemark coordinator, ticket validation fails and the agent is marked unhealthy. On-call: check NTP sync status before restarting anything; a restart without resync just repeats the failure. To query the coordinator's skew report endpoint directly, authenticate with the bearer token below.

session JWT of yawep-yawep = eyJhbGciOiJIUzI1NiIsInR5cCI6IkpXVCJ9.eyJzdWIiOiI3pWF3_In0.aXYsHiog

Visiting contractors at Quillbarrow Systems may enter the hardware lab on Level 2 only when accompanied by a sponsoring engineer. Tools must be logged at the bench by the door, and no photography is permitted inside. Protective footwear is mandatory past the yellow line. The lab door stays locked at all times; your escort will use the pass code below.

door code, yagap-bahof: bdg-O-05

### Step 4: Configure the reconciliation job

The Ledgerloom inventory reconciliation job runs nightly against the Countwise warehouse database and flags quantity drift above the configured threshold. Before enabling the scheduler, copy `env.sample` to `.env` on the batch host and review the retention and threshold values — defaults are acceptable for most regions. The job cannot authenticate to the Countwise API without its service credential, so append the following line to the `.env` file:

vault entry, kagep-yajeg: COURIER_KEY5=da097